DETROIT—The Armenian Youth Federation – YOARF annual Olympic weekend is headed back to Detroit, Michigan, this coming Labor Day weekend and the steering committee is hard at work to make the 81st a memorable one.
The AYF’s 81th annual 2014 Olympic Games will be held at the Adoba Hotel located in Dearborn, Michigan. Built in a postmodern architectural style, this environmentally friendly Detroit Metro hotel overlooks Ford World Headquarters, the Henry Ford Museum and the suburb of Dearborn.
The Adoba hotel is centrally located between downtown Detroit and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port, presenting a stunning exterior of glass and a dramatic atrium lobby. The Adoba Hotel has many amenities such as complimentary Wi-Fi in the guest rooms, complimentary parking, indoor pool, 24-hour fitness center and brand new Smart Flat Screen TV’s.
